Indonesians’ Paylater debts soar, driving BNPL growth and rising loan defaults

The Financial Services Authority (OJK) revealed that Indonesian Paylater debts jumped by 48 percent from the same period of the previous year to Rp20.5 trillion (US$1.3 billion), while the Buy Now Pay Later (BNPL) receivables in financing companies and banks were recorded at Rp30.36 trillion.

KPPU targets resolution, fines payment of Google monopoly case

The Business Competition Supervisory Commission (KPPU) is targeting the case of alleged Google monopoly violations through Google Play Store and its Google Play Billing (GBP) to be resolved this month, with Google being the subject to a sanction of 50 percent of the net profit of the GBP application.

Salt industry faces challenges, focuses on quality improvement, expansion

The Indonesian Food and Beverage Entrepreneurs Association (GAPMMI) reveals that locally produced salt cannot yet be used in the food and beverage industry, with product damage reaching 60 percent in the production process.
